HPCC Systems offers an open source, data-intensive supercomputing platform (HPCC) that is designed for the enterprise to resolve Big Data challenges.
HPCC Systems from LexisNexis Risk Solutions offers a proven, open-source, data-intensive supercomputing platform designed for the enterprise to solve big data problems. As an alternative to Hadoop, HPCC Systems offers a consistent data-centric programming language, two data platforms and a single architecture for efficient processing. Customers who already leverage the HPCC Systems technology through LexisNexis products and services include banks, insurance companies, law enforcing agencies, federal government and other enterprise-class organizations.

HPCC Systems is an open-source data-intensive supercomputing platform developed by LexisNexis Risk Solutions. It provides a comprehensive suite of services designed to help enterprises tackle Big Data challenges. The platform includes powerful tools for data processing, data delivery, and analytics, utilizing its unique architecture that features the Thor data processing engine and the Roxie data delivery engine. Additionally, HPCC Systems employs the Data Centric Language (ECL) for efficient data manipulation and querying.
The Thor engine is designed for batch processing of large datasets, making it ideal for complex data transformations and analytics. It excels at handling massive volumes of data and is optimized for high-throughput processing. In contrast, the Roxie engine is focused on real-time data delivery and querying, allowing users to access and analyze data quickly and efficiently. Together, these engines provide a robust solution for both data processing and immediate data access needs.
HPCC Systems is versatile and can be applied across various industries, including finance, healthcare, telecommunications, retail, and government. Organizations in these sectors can leverage HPCC Systems to manage large datasets, perform complex analytics, and gain insights that drive decision-making. For example, financial institutions can use it for risk analysis and fraud detection, while healthcare organizations can analyze patient data for improved outcomes.
